Surface Prep work



Prior to painting your home, ensure to completely prepare the surfaces by cleaning and fixing any flaws. Begin by cleaning the walls with a light cleaning agent remedy to remove dust, dirt, and grease. Utilize a sponge or fabric to scrub gently, making certain all surface areas are clean and dry prior to continuing.

Evaluate the wall surfaces for any kind of fractures, openings, or peeling off paint. Complete any voids with spackling substance, sanding it smooth as soon as completely dry. For larger openings, think about making use of a patch package for a seamless finish.

Next off, meticulously check the trim, baseboards, and crown molding. Wipe them down with a moist fabric to remove any grime or deposit. Look for any dents or scrapes that need to be filled up and fined sand.

Don't forget about the ceilings-- clean them thoroughly and resolve any type of flaws before painting.

Color and Finish Choice



To achieve the preferred visual for your home, meticulously select the shades and finishes that will certainly enhance the total look of each space. When selecting colors, consider the mood you intend to produce in each room. Lighter shades can make a space feel more roomy and ventilated, while darker tones can add heat and comfort. Think of the all-natural light that gets in the room and exactly how it might impact the color throughout the day.



Along with shade, the coating of the paint is additionally crucial. Matte coatings can conceal imperfections however may be more difficult to cleanse, while satin and semi-gloss finishes are more long lasting and cleanable. tulsa cabinet painting finishes can add a touch of sophistication however might highlight flaws in the wall surfaces.

Remember that various rooms might take advantage of different color pattern and finishes based on their function and the ambience you want to develop.

Make the effort to examine small spots of paint on the walls to see how they search in different lighting conditions before making your decision.

Furniture and Decoration Defense



Take into consideration covering your furniture and decor things to protect them from paint splatters and leaks during the professional painting procedure. Usage plastic ground cloth or old bedsheets to protect your possessions from unintentional spills.

Move furnishings to the center of the room or right into one more area far from the walls being painted. If moving huge products isn't feasible, group them with each other and cover with safety products.

For smaller decor pieces, eliminate them from the room completely if practical. If removing them isn't an option, very carefully wrap them in plastic or towel to stop paint damage.
